The hutch is built with hardwoods and select walnut veneers and is stained to a royal cherry color. Its 3-inch thick shaped edge profile is complemented by wood picture frame molding. The hutch has two open shelves. Its dimensions are 36-inch wide by 20-inch deep by 45-inch high, giving you the measurements needed to evaluate the available wall and desk space before specifying the station.
